📌 Real Action Plan for Real Change

🎯 Step 1: List out who drains your energy & why.
🎯 Step 2: Reduce interactions or reframe conversations.
🎯 Step 3: Learn polite “No” scripts—“Let’s talk about something positive.”
🎯 Step 4: Unfollow negative pages, chats, or influencers.
🎯 Step 5: Surround yourself with mentors, visionaries, and doers.
🎯 Step 6: Reflect daily—“Am I allowing toxic energy into my space?”
